What Happens When You Connect Slow Devices to Gigabit Ethernet?

Now that you’re aware that devices have different speed capacities, you must be curious what will happen to the device when you connect a slow one to the Gigabit port. To begin this discussion, it’s important that you understand that this does not instantly upgrade your device to use Gigabit internet. As a matter of fact, the connections to these devices will still function normally. The only difference you will see when you connect slow devices to Gigabit Ethernet is its performance—it will evidently perform at a lower rated speed.

Common Uses of Optical Fiber Cables

To help you get a good grasp of how fiber optic technology is used all around the world, here is a list of the most popular uses of fiber optic cables:

  • Internet Connection

It is well-known across in the field of fiber optics that fiber optic cables have the capacity to transmit a large amount of data at high speed. Because of this, the technology became widely used across business organizations for internet cables. Unlike the traditional copper wire cables, fiber optic cables can carry more data. Hence, fiber optics became a popular choice for companies that wanted to acquire high-quality internet.

  • Cable Television

Over the years, optical fiber has been used by organizations to transmit cable signals all around the world. Fiber optic cables provide its end-users higher bandwidth and faster network speed. For this reason, this innovation became an ideal choice for entities that want to transmit high definition television signals.

  • Telephone

In the past, the task of calling telephones outside or within the country was never as easy as it is today. It was because of the emergence of fiber optic technologies that faster connections and clearer conversations became possible without the worry of lags on either side. With that said, it is a known fact that fiber optics revolutionized the telecommunication industry.

  • Computer Networking

With the help of fiber optics, networking between multiple computers within a single building or across nearby structures became easier than ever. Those that made use of the technology were able to see a marked decrease in the time it took for their computers to transfer files across several networks. Because of that, this technology became commonly used by organizations to enhance their site’s computer networking.

  • Surgery and Dentistry

Apart from the ones mentioned above, fiber optic cables were also widely used in the field of medicine and research. Over the past few years, optical communication has been widely used to aid doctors that are practicing surgery and dentistry. Most of the time it was an essential part of non-intrusive surgical methods like endoscopy. Moreover, fiber optics is also maximized by users that perform microscopy and biomedical research.

  • Automotive Industry

It is beyond any doubt that fiber optic cables play a significant role in the lighting and safety features of modern automobiles. With this technology, organizations gain the ability to conserve space and provide superior lighting in vehicles. As a matter of fact, it is renowned among technicians that fiber optic technology is great for both interior and exterior lighting. Moreover, fiber optic cables were also able to prove its worth to business owners by transmitting signals between different parts of the vehicle at lightning speed. For this exact reason, this technology became invaluable for company owners that wanted to implement safety applications.
